Cleaning and care

Check your dishwasher regularly (ap-
prox. every 4 - 6 months). This way
faults and problems can be avoided.
The external surfaces of the
dishwasher are susceptible to
scratching.
Contact with unsuitable cleaning
agents can alter or discolour the ex-
ternal surfaces.

Cleaning the wash cabinet

The wash cabinet is largely self-clean-
ing, provided that the correct amount of
detergent is always used.
If, however, there are limescale or
grease deposits in the cabinet, these
can be removed with a special dish-
washer cleaner (see "Optional ac-
cessories"). Follow the instructions on
the packaging.
Using mainly low temperature pro-
grammes (below 50 °C), could cause
bacteria and unpleasant odours to build
up in the wash cabinet. To avoid this,
the Intensive 75°C programme should
be run once a month.
 Clean the filters in the wash cabinet
regularly.

Cleaning the door and the door
seal
Mould could build up on the door seal
and the sides of the dishwasher door as
these surfaces are outside the wash
cabinet and so not accessed and
cleaned by the spray arm jets.
 Wipe the door seal regularly with a
damp cloth to remove food deposits.
 Wipe off any food or drink residues
which may have dripped onto the
sides of dishwasher door before clos-
ing it.

Cleaning the control panel

 The control panel should only be
wiped with a damp cloth.
